Egale Canada is a national Canadian charity and advocacy organization that works to advance the rights, safety, and inclusion of 2SLGBTQI people. It conducts community-based research, delivers education and training for schools and workplaces, runs national resource hubs (including a centre on 2SLGBTQI aging), and pursues legal advocacy and public awareness campaigns to influence policy and protect rights.
